Las Animas County, founded in 1866, is the largest county by area in Colorado with a total of 4,775 square miles. It shares a boundary with northern New Mexico. The population was 14,555 in 2020. The county seat is Trinidad, one of the original stops on the Santa Fe Trail.
Trinidad Lake State Park is a scenic, 2,700-acre recreation center that surrounds Trinidad Lake at the base of the Culebra Range of the Sangre de Cristo Mountains. Camping in every season and abundant water sports make this a popular base from which to explore the entire southeast region.
